Volume II of the unrivalled textbook contains the quantum theory of scattering by a potential, addition of angular momenta, time-independent and time-dependent perturbation theory, and systems of identical particles. The new edition also includes a new complement in order to treat an important subject that was missing in the previous editions: the linear response theory, very often used in many fields of physics such as atomic physics and quantum optics, condensed matter physics, and nuclear physics. The textbook retains its typical style also in the third edition: it explains the fundamental concepts in chapters which are elaborated in accompanying complements that provide more detailed discussions, examples and applications.
